None of those mentioned.

Echoboy has many different delay styles and in addition to the many features for manipulating the delay, there are different saturation types modeled after many sought after classic delay units. Having echoboy is like owning 10 different delay plugins.

CoCo does BBD, with multiple "color" types and mild saturation. It is a very specific delay type with added options for expanding capabilities and coloring of sound. Its fairly limited.

The closest, but definitely not replacements, based on features would be McDSP EC-300 Echo Collection or Blue Cat Late Replies + McDSP Futzbox... Because of Blue Cat Late Replies ability to host plugin effects, they make a good case for a must-own without comparisons to other tools, because much of comparing delay plugins comes down to obviously sound, but more importantly what goes into achieving that sound... Filtering, Saturation, Timing manipulation, panning manipulation and more.

I own probably too many of these delay plugins mentioned and there's a use for all of them, but I have not seen a single replacement for Echoboy. Even Soundtoys has multiple delays in addition to Echoboy (Crystalizer, Primaltap, and Phasemistress [remember Echoboy has some amazing chorus built in too]) so there's room for all and anyone to have their favorites for different uses, but again even with the Necro'd thread... there's still no 1 replacement for Echoboy.
